Why Metabolism Changes After 40

As men enter their 40s, several key systems become more sensitive. These shifts often overlap, creating a perfect storm for metabolic slowdown.

1. Blood Sugar Becomes Harder to Regulate

This leads to:

  • afternoon energy crashes
  • increased cravings
  • fat storage around the abdomen
  • irritability and brain fog

2. Stress Hormones Stay Elevated Longer

Chronic cortisol affects:

  • sleep
  • mood
  • weight gain
  • inflammation
  • recovery

3. Testosterone Becomes More Responsive to Lifestyle Stressors

Blood sugar swings, poor sleep, and chronic stress can all impact:

  • motivation
  • confidence
  • libido
  • muscle recovery
  • mental clarity

Supporting metabolic health is one of the most effective ways to support hormonal health.

The Blood Sugar–Testosterone Link Most Men Don’t Know About

One of the most important — and overlooked — aspects of men’s health is the connection between glucose stability and testosterone.

When blood sugar spikes and crashes throughout the day, it can lead to:

  • increased abdominal fat
  • lower energy
  • reduced drive
  • mood instability
  • slower recovery
  • disrupted sleep

These symptoms often show up long before any lab test reveals a problem.

Signs Your Metabolism Needs Support

If you’re a man over 40, look out for these early indicators of metabolic imbalance:

  • stubborn belly fat
  • low morning energy
  • difficulty building or maintaining muscle
  • poor sleep quality
  • cravings, especially in the evening
  • irritability or brain fog
  • slower recovery after workouts
  • feeling “not quite yourself”

These are not failures of discipline — they’re signals that your metabolism needs a different strategy.
